linux查看文件夹下的所有文件权限命令行

worktile 其他 154

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ux系统中,可以使用命令行来查看文件夹下的所有文件权限。常用的命令有`ls`和`ll`。

    1. 使用`ls`命令

    `ls`命令用于列出指定文件夹中的文件和文件夹信息。默认情况下,它只显示文件名,不包括文件权限。

    若要查看文件权限,可以使用`ls -l`命令,它会以长格式显示文件和文件夹的详细信息,包括文件权限。

    例如,要查看当前文件夹下的所有文件权限,可以执行以下命令:
    “`
    ls -l
    “`
    输出结果会包含类似 `-rw-r–r–` 的文件权限信息。

    2. 使用`ll`命令

    `ll`命令是`ls -l`的一个简写形式,它可以直接显示文件权限信息,而不需要额外的参数。

    例如,要查看当前文件夹下的所有文件权限,可以执行以下命令:
    “`
    ll
    “`
    输出结果会以长格式显示文件和文件夹的详细信息,包括文件权限。

    以上就是Linux系统中使用命令行查看文件夹下所有文件权限的方法。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ux中,可以使用命令行来查看一个文件夹下所有文件的权限。以下是几个常用的命令:

    1. ls命令:使用ls命令可以列出一个文件夹下的所有文件和子文件夹。加上参数-l可以以长格式显示文件详细信息,其中包括文件的权限信息。

    例如,要查看当前文件夹下所有文件的权限,可以使用以下命令:
    “`
    ls -l
    “`
    该命令将列出当前文件夹下所有文件和子文件夹的详细信息,包括每个文件的权限。

    2. find命令:使用find命令可以递归地查找一个文件夹下的所有文件,并可以通过执行其他命令来查看文件权限。

    例如,要查看当前文件夹下所有文件的权限,可以使用以下命令:
    “`
    find . -type f -exec ls -l {} \;
    “`
    该命令将递归地查找当前文件夹下的所有文件,并使用ls -l命令查看每个文件的权限。

    3. stat命令:使用stat命令可以查看文件的详细信息,其中包括文件的权限信息。

    例如,要查看一个特定文件的权限,可以使用以下命令:
    “`
    stat filename
    “`
    将”filename”替换为要查看的文件名。

    4. file命令:使用file命令可以查看文件的类型和权限。

    例如,要查看一个特定文件的权限,可以使用以下命令:
    “`
    file filename
    “`
    将”filename”替换为要查看的文件名。

    5. getfacl命令:在一些特殊情况下,文件的权限可能由ACL(访问控制列表)控制,此时可以使用getfacl命令来查看文件的权限。

    例如,要查看一个特定文件的ACL权限,可以使用以下命令:
    “`
    getfacl filename
    “`
    将”filename”替换为要查看的文件名。

    这些命令可以帮助你在命令行中查看一个文件夹下所有文件的权限。使用上述命令之一,你可以获取文件的详细权限信息,包括所有者权限、群组权限和其他用户权限。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ux系统中,可以通过使用命令行来查看文件夹下所有文件的权限。以下是一些常用的命令和操作流程:

    1. 使用”ls”命令:最简单的方法是使用ls命令,它可以列出指定文件夹下所有文件和目录的详细信息。执行以下命令:
    “`
    ls -l
    “`
    这将列出指定文件夹下的所有文件和目录的详细信息,包括文件权限。

    2. 使用”find”命令:find命令可以在指定目录中查找文件,并可以使用”ls -l”命令来显示文件详细信息和权限。执行以下命令:
    “`
    find /path/to/directory -type f -exec ls -l {} \;
    “`
    将”/path/to/directory”替换为要查看权限的目录的路径。这个命令将递归地查找目录中的所有文件,并显示每个文件的详细信息和权限。

    3. 使用”stat”命令:stat命令可以显示指定文件的详细信息,包括权限。执行以下命令:
    “`
    stat /path/to/file
    “`
    将”/path/to/file”替换为要查看权限的文件的路径。这个命令将显示指定文件的详细信息,包括权限。

    4. 使用”ls”命令和通配符:可以使用ls命令结合通配符来列出满足条件的文件,并显示其权限。例如,要列出所有以”.txt”结尾的文件的权限,执行以下命令:
    “`
    ls -l *.txt
    “`
    这将显示所有以”.txt”结尾的文件的详细信息和权限。

    总结:
    以上是通过命令行在Linux系统中查看文件夹下所有文件的权限的几种常用方法。使用ls命令、find命令和stat命令可以分别实现该功能,并且可以根据实际需求使用通配符来筛选特定类型的文件。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部